LACHIN: Prime Minister (PM) Shehbaz Sharif arrived Tuesday in Azerbaijan on the third leg of his four-nation tour, where he is scheduled to participate in a top-level Pakistan-Turkiye-Azerbaijan trilateral meeting.
Upon arrival at Lachin Airport, prime minister Shehbaz was warmly received by Azerbaijan’s Foreign Minister Jeyhun Bayramov, senior diplomat Qasim Mohiuddin, and other members of the Azerbaijani diplomatic corps.
During his visit, PM Shehbaz Sharif will hold a bilateral meeting with Azerbaijani President Ilham Aliyev, in addition to the trilateral summit involving President Aliyev and Turkish President Recep Tayyip Erdoğan.
PM Shehbaz, on the visit, is accompanied by foreign minister Ishaq Dar, federal Information minister Attaullah Tarar, and Special Assistant Tariq Fatemi.
Following his engagements in Azerbaijan, the prime minister will proceed to Tajikistan, the final stop of his diplomatic tour.

A day earlier (Monday), PM Shehbaz, while touching on his visit to Tehran, said that Iranian President Masoud Pezeshkian expressed his serious concerns over the recent grave developments in the Subcontinent – an obvious reference to the May 7-10 Pakistan-India war.
He also said that Pakistan was ready to hold talks with India on water, counterterrorism and Kashmir, if New Delhi showed seriousness. If it wasn’t the case, then he promised to defend the country like Islamabad did in the recent conflict, the prime minister made it clear.
